You’ve committed to a vegetarian diet—but is it okay to bend the rules with a vegetarian cheat day once in a while?
Going vegetarian is a personal journey, and there’s no one-size-fits-all rulebook—so if you’re wondering whether a cheat day makes you “less” vegetarian, let’s set the record straight: it doesn’t! Your diet is yours to shape, and an occasional indulgence doesn’t erase your commitment.
But here’s the catch—cheat days can be a slippery slope, making it all too easy to slip back into old habits without realizing it.
That’s why this post is here to help you figure out if cheat days are a smart choice for you and, if they are, how to approach them without undoing your progress.
Let’s dive in!
- To Cheat or Not To Cheat?
- Why You Might Want to Cheat (And Why That’s Totally Understandable)
- Should You Cheat on Your Vegetarian Diet? Questions to Ask Yourself
- Why You Should Wait Before Allowing Vegetarian Cheat Days
- How to Cheat Without Losing Progress (If You Decide to Cheat)
- What to Do If Your Cheat Days Get Out of Hand
- Alternative Ways to Indulge Without Breaking Your Commitment
- Cheat Days Are Your Choice, But Choose Wisely
To Cheat or Not To Cheat?
When it comes to maintaining a vegetarian diet, one of the most common debates is whether or not to allow yourself a cheat day. For some, it’s a firm “no,” while for others, it’s seen as a necessary and occasional indulgence.
There’s no universal rule when it comes to food choices, and deciding whether to have a vegetarian cheat day is a personal decision that hinges on your lifestyle, goals, and values.
For those of us who have navigated this dilemma, it can be difficult to maintain a strict plant-based diet, especially when temptation or social pressures arise.
I can personally relate to this struggle; there was a time when I allowed myself to eat fish “just once in a while,” and before I knew it, I was regularly consuming seafood, which contradicted my vegetarian principles. I found myself questioning my choices and my commitment to my values.
Looking back, I wish I had set clearer boundaries to maintain consistency and focus on my health, environment, and ethical goals.
Why You Might Want to Cheat (And Why That’s Totally Understandable)
At times, even the most dedicated vegetarians can feel the urge to indulge in non-vegetarian foods. Peer pressure, cravings, or nostalgia can all play a role in tempting you to have a cheat day, and it’s important to recognize these feelings without guilt.
Social Situations Can Be Tough
Social gatherings can be one of the most challenging aspects of adhering to a vegetarian diet. Imagine attending a barbecue, where the air smells of grilled meats, and your plate looks bare compared to the towering piles of burgers and steaks on everyone else’s plates.
Or perhaps you’re at a holiday dinner, and it feels like you’re missing out on the centerpiece of the meal—like Thanksgiving turkey or Christmas ham.
These situations can bring about feelings of exclusion, or even guilt, as you navigate social pressure and family expectations.
When you’re the only vegetarian in the room, and everyone around you is indulging in dishes you once loved, the temptation to “cheat” may feel overwhelming. Allowing yourself a cheat day under these circumstances may seem like the simplest solution to avoid conflict or awkwardness.
However, while it might seem harmless in the moment, this can open the door to more frequent indulgences, especially if the social pressure continues to mount.
Learn strategies for navigating social situations as a new vegetarian.

You Miss Your Favorite Foods
Cravings are powerful. While many people transition to a vegetarian diet for ethical, health, or environmental reasons, it’s important to acknowledge that taste preferences don’t vanish overnight.
If you grew up enjoying certain foods—like bacon, chicken wings, and steak—those flavors are deeply ingrained in your memory. The emotional attachment to those foods can make it difficult to resist the temptation, especially when you find yourself in situations where the craving is triggered by sight or smell.
Even the most committed vegetarians may, at times, wish they could enjoy some of their old favorites without guilt. So, when these cravings hit, the thought of allowing yourself a cheat day may seem like an easy way to momentarily satisfy those desires.
It’s crucial to evaluate whether a cheat day will lead to long-term fulfillment or if it’s just a temporary fix that could ultimately undermine your efforts.
Tradition & Nostalgia Play a Role
Food is often more than just sustenance—it’s an integral part of culture, tradition, and family bonding. Certain meals carry sentimental value, reminding us of childhood memories, holiday celebrations, or special moments shared with loved ones.
For example, you might have fond memories of your grandmother’s famous meatballs or the turkey your family always made for Thanksgiving.
Skipping out on these dishes, even when you’ve transitioned to a vegetarian lifestyle, may feel like you’re disconnecting from cherished traditions. For some, the act of indulging in a familiar dish once in a while—on holidays, birthdays, or other milestones—might seem like a way to hold on to those special connections, despite a shift toward plant-based eating.

You Want to Feel Less Restricted
A vegetarian diet can feel restrictive for some, particularly if they’re new to the lifestyle. It’s not uncommon to feel overwhelmed or frustrated by the limitations of a plant-based eating plan, especially if it requires cooking separately from family members or avoiding certain social events that revolve around food.
If you’re struggling with these feelings of restriction, a cheat day might provide a temporary sense of freedom. Some people may find that giving themselves permission to indulge every so often can help them stay on track long-term, feeling less burdened by their dietary choices.
But before deciding to take this route, it’s essential to assess whether this freedom will truly help you maintain your commitment to the lifestyle in the long term or if it will create more challenges.

Should You Cheat on Your Vegetarian Diet? Questions to Ask Yourself
Before deciding to have a cheat day, it’s essential to reflect on your reasons for being vegetarian and how you might feel afterward. Asking yourself a few key questions can help you make a decision that aligns with your values and long-term goals.
Consider Your WHY
The first and most important question to ask yourself is: Why did you choose to go vegetarian in the first place?
If your decision was primarily based on ethical considerations—such as animal welfare or the environment—then cheating on your diet may feel like a violation of your values. Some people may experience pretty intense guilt if they give in to the temptation of eating meat, even occasionally.
If your motivation stems from health concerns, such as lowering cholesterol or improving digestion, the impact of a cheat day may not be as significant in the short term. However, it’s important to think about the long-term effects of cheating regularly—could it undermine your progress toward these health goals?
Reflecting on your motivations will help guide your decision.
Think About How You’ll Feel After Cheating
Before you indulge, take a moment to think about the potential aftermath. Will the satisfaction you get from eating a non-vegetarian dish outweigh any feelings of guilt or regret that may follow?
In many cases, cravings are short-lived, but the emotional impact of straying from your goals can linger for days, leading to frustration and a diminished sense of accomplishment.

Why You Should Wait Before Allowing Vegetarian Cheat Days
Before allowing yourself a cheat day, it’s important to give your vegetarian diet time to become a solid habit. Rushing into cheat days too early can undermine your progress and make it harder to stay on track in the long run.
Don’t Cheat Until Your Vegetarian Diet Feels Like Second Nature
One of the biggest mistakes people make when transitioning to a vegetarian lifestyle is allowing cheat days too early.
When you first make the switch, your body and mind are still adjusting to the new habits, and the temptation to cheat may be stronger during this period. It can take several months for plant-based eating to feel truly ingrained in your routine.
If you introduce cheat days too soon, you risk undermining your efforts to establish healthy habits, much like how skipping workouts during the early stages of a fitness program can make it harder to stay consistent.
Cheating Requires Strong Boundaries to Avoid Backsliding
It’s easy to think of a cheat day as a harmless indulgence, but it can quickly spiral out of control if you don’t have firm boundaries in place. One cheat meal may turn into multiple cheats per week, as old habits resurface and cravings take over.
If you don’t have a clear plan for limiting cheats, you may find yourself unintentionally abandoning your vegetarian diet altogether.

How to Cheat Without Losing Progress (If You Decide to Cheat)
If you choose to have a cheat day, it’s essential to approach it with a strategy to ensure you don’t derail your progress. Setting clear boundaries and making mindful decisions can help you indulge without compromising your long-term goals.
Set Clear Boundaries
Be sure to define strict boundaries in advance. For instance, you might choose to limit yourself to a specific type of meat or only cheat on certain occasions, like when you’re attending a special event.
Personally I allow myself to eat fish only if someone else is preparing a meal for me.
Setting these parameters helps you avoid a slippery slope where cheating becomes the norm rather than the exception.
Exhaust Other Solutions First
Before reaching for non-vegetarian food, try running through all of the strategies for overcoming meat cravings first. You may just find that your temptation to cheat isn’t that strong after all – you just needed a plan for how to handle the situation.
Give Yourself Grace If You Cheat & Regret It
One of the most important things to remember is that a single cheat doesn’t define your entire diet. If you slip up and regret your choice, it’s crucial not to spiral into guilt.
Instead, use the experience as a learning opportunity to reinforce your commitment to your vegetarian goals. Acknowledge that mistakes happen, but don’t let them derail your progress.

What to Do If Your Cheat Days Get Out of Hand
If cheat days start becoming more frequent than you’d planned, it’s important to reassess your approach and regain control. Reflecting on your goals and setting clear boundaries can help you get back on track and stay true to your vegetarian lifestyle.
Revisit Your WHY
If you find yourself cheating more often than planned, take a step back and revisit your initial reasons for adopting a vegetarian diet. Reflecting on your values and goals will help you reframe your relationship with food and remind you of why this lifestyle matters to you.
Set Clear Goals to Get Back on Track
Once you’ve reflected on your reasons, establish clear, actionable goals to help you regain control. This might involve eliminating cheat days altogether, reducing their frequency, or focusing on indulgent vegetarian meals instead.
Set yourself up for success by creating a plan that aligns with your long-term vision. You can use the tools inside Veg Vision to help you with this.
Recognize Your Triggers
Understanding the factors that lead to cheating—whether it’s social pressure, emotional cravings, or convenience—is crucial for staying on track. Identifying your triggers allows you to make better choices in the future, whether it’s bringing your own vegetarian dish to a party or planning meals ahead of time to avoid last-minute temptations.
Be Kind to Yourself, But Stay Accountable
While it’s important to practice self-compassion, don’t let a few slip-ups undermine your commitment. Stay accountable to your goals, and remember that every meal offers a fresh opportunity to align your choices with your values.

Alternative Ways to Indulge Without Breaking Your Commitment
If you’re craving something indulgent but want to stay true to your vegetarian lifestyle, there are plenty of creative ways to satisfy your desires without compromising your values.
Satisfy Your Cravings with Vegetarian Versions
When cravings strike, try recreating your favorite non-vegetarian dishes with plant-based ingredients. Whether it’s a veggie-packed pizza, a creamy mac and cheese, or a smoky lentil chili, satisfying your cravings doesn’t always require compromising your values.
Allow “Cheat Meals” That Stick to Your Vegetarian Values
Rather than allowing yourself a full-on cheat day, treat yourself to an indulgent vegetarian meal that’s rich, comforting, and filling. It could be a super cheesy pasta dish the most chocolatey dessert. You can still indulge without straying from your commitment to vegetarianism.
Find New Favorite Comfort Foods
Explore new plant-based cuisines and dishes from around the world. Many cultures feature rich, flavorful vegetarian meals, from Indian curries to Mediterranean mezze plates. Trying new recipes and expanding your palate can help you rediscover the joys of plant-based eating while staying true to your dietary goals.
Learn more strategies for overcoming meat cravings as a new vegetarian.

Cheat Days Are Your Choice, But Choose Wisely
Ultimately, deciding whether to allow yourself a vegetarian cheat day is a deeply personal decision. There is no one-size-fits-all answer, and the key lies in making an informed choice that aligns with your goals, values, and lifestyle.
If you choose to indulge, set clear boundaries, be mindful of your triggers, and don’t let one slip-up derail your progress.
Above all, remember that your journey is yours to navigate, and it’s up to you to make the decisions that will keep you feeling fulfilled, healthy, and aligned with your values.
You got this!
XO – Bailee

If you want to save this post for later, pin it with one of the images below! 🙂



